Once upon a time there lived a kind, funny, and faithful woman, Ruth Matheny. The youngest of three, she was born in Odessa, Texas, on August 15, 1960, to Lloyd and Peggy Roberts and grew up to love family, music, and God. Leaving home at 19, she first pursued a career in music therapy at West Texas State University but soon heard the distant chants, "Saw varsity's horns off " and was drawn by the siren's call to Texas A&M University. There she discovered her love for teaching and met the love of her life, Corey Matheny, and soon they married
Those early years were not always easy-she experienced Hodgkins Lymphoma and serious blood clots-but they were filled with love and laughter. She fought through with the same quiet strength that would define her final days-ever a fighter. She went on to become a teacher in the Houston area and eventually had three children-Rachel, Ryan, and Jacob. In 2000, she moved with her family to
Granbury, Texas and over time built lasting friendships that would sustain her through her hardest days. She retired in 2020, after 35 years of teaching, but was never one to sit still, even in retirement, and started a gourmet, oven-fired pizza business with her friends.
She passed away on May 8th, 2025, in her own home in
Granbury, Texas.
Ruth Matheny was a kind, loving, stubborn human being known for her sharp wit and humor, compassion, and faith. To know her was to know warmth, laughter, and a fierce unwavering love. Her love for life was infectious and she loved to travel and experience the world. She loved musicals, horror movies, and her dogs. She cherished her family and friends, and her smile and laughter never failed to lift everyone around her. Ruth made the world a better place, her warmth radiating in every direction, touching the lives of everyone she leaves behind: Corey Matheny (husband), Rachel Matheny (daughter) and Annaliese Dempsey (wife), Ryan Matheny (eldest son) and Chello Miller (partner), Jacob Matheny (youngest son) and Rahul Ramchandran (husband); Rebecca Georgiades (sister), David Roberts (brother) and Jean Roberts (wife); and, numerous nieces and nephews Kevin Georgiades, Laura Opris, Matthew Georgiades, William Roberts, Christina Pineda, Caleb Roberts, and Adrianna Roberts.
